This biomass pelletizer employs a ring die roller compression method to transform loose biomass feedstock into compact, high-density pellets. Through powerful mechanical compression, it activates the natural binders within the material to form uniform pellets—without any chemical additives. Designed for high-capacity production lines, this equipment serves as a vital manufacturing solution in the renewable fuel and sustainable energy sectors.
Ring-die biomass pellet machine processing various biomass materials including wood sawdust, crop straws, rice husks, peanut shells, bamboo scraps, and other agricultural/forestry wastes into high-density pellets. The machine efficiently handles materials with moisture content below 15% and particle size under 5mm for optimal pelletizing performance.
